A RESOLUTION SETTING COMPENSATION FOR ELECTION JUDGES AND CLERKS IN FRANKLIN COUNTY, KANSAS
WHEREAS, Franklin County is a duly organized and empowered municipal government having home rule powers under K.S.A. 19-191., and;
WHEREAS, K.S.A. 25-2811, establishes that all election judges and clerks shall receive compensation for their services which amount shall be not less than the sum of $40.00 per day; and
WHEREFORE, all election judges and clerks in Franklin County, Kansas shall receive the sum of $6.00 per hour for services rendered but in no case shall receive less than $40.00 per day for time worked. All judges or clerks may decline to receive compensation for the work they perform and shall indicate in writing if they wish to decline payment for their services.
NOW TH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E BOARD OF COUNTY COMMISSIONERS OF FRANKLIN COUNTY, KANSAS
That, pursuant to K.S.A. 25-2811, judges and clerks in Franklin County, Kansas shall receive an hourly rate of $6.00 per hour for services rendered but at no time shall receive less than $40.00 per day and shall receive compensation for their mileage at the rate of reimbursement pursuant to K.S.A. 75-3202a.
This resolution shall be effective upon its adoption by the Board of County Commissioners.
Passed and adopted in regular session this 8th day of August, 2007.
